Mid-America Apartment Communities Inc. (MAA) reported Q1 2026 earnings per share of $1.06, handily beating the consensus estimate of $0.8091 by a margin of approximately 31%. Revenue figures were not disclosed in the available data, and no comparable estimates were provided. Following the announcement, MAA’s stock edged up 0.87%, reflecting cautious investor optimism driven by the upside in profitability.

MAA’s first-quarter performance was underpinned by robust occupancy and rental rate management across its Sun Belt portfolio. The company reported EPS of $1.06, significantly exceeding street expectations. While revenue line items were absent from the release, the earnings beat suggests disciplined cost control and stable same-store operating metrics. Margins likely benefited from lower-than-expected property-level expenses and effective rent collection. The residential multifamily sector continues to face headwinds from elevated new supply in key markets such as Atlanta and Nashville, yet MAA’s portfolio diversification may have mitigated some of that pressure. Quarterly same-store net operating income growth, though not explicitly stated, could have remained positive given the EPS surprise. MAA also maintained a strong balance sheet with manageable leverage and ample liquidity, positioning it for potential capital recycling or selective acquisitions in the back half of the year. The stock’s modest 0.87% gain following the release indicates that while the EPS beat was substantial, the absence of revenue figures leaves some uncertainty. Analysts may view the strong EPS as a sign of effective management execution, but some could also note that the beat might be partially driven by one-time items or lower deferred maintenance costs. Valuation for multifamily REITs remains tied to interest rate expectations, and MAA’s shares may trade near fair value given current rate volatility. Investment implications hinge on the company’s ability to sustain occupancy above 95% and manage expense growth. What to watch next quarter includes same-store revenue and NOI metrics, leasing spreads, and any updates on development pipeline. If supply pressures ease or demand strengthens, MAA could see upward earnings revisions. Conversely, any signs of erosion in operating metrics might dampen the positive sentiment from this quarter’s EPS surprise.
